A protocol is an agreed set of rules and signals thats control how signals are sent.
File Transfer Protocol is used to allow computers to upload and download files.
Voip(Voice Over Internet Protocol) is a protocol that allows you to send phone messages over the internet istead of by phone lines
HTTP(Hypertext Transfer Protocol) is the protocol used to allow computers to share web oages, it controls the commuications between computers.
